Gold for Guliyev at Euros, hurdler Herman ends German hopes

-

World champion Ramil Guliyev won the men’s 200 meters at the European Athletics Championsh­ips on Thursday, and Elvira Herman of Belarus denied German hopes of gold in the women’s 100-meter hurdles.

Turkey’s Guliyev set a championsh­ip record of 19.76 seconds in beating Britain’s Nethaneel Mitchell-Blake and Switzerlan­d’s Alex Wilson.

The 21-year-old Herman clocked 12.67 seconds to beat Olympic bronze medalist Pamela Dutkiewicz (12.72) and Cindy Roleder (12.77) — both of Germany — for her first medal at a major meet.

Olympic champion Thomas Roehler won gold in front of home supporters in the javelin with a throw of 89.47 meters, beating German compatriot Andreas Hofmann and Estonia’s Magnus Kirt. World champion Johannes Vetter finished fifth.

World champion Karsten Warholm of Norway won the men’s 400-meter hurdles in 47.64, ahead of Turkey’s Yasmani Copello and Ireland’s Thomas Barr.
